在Java中,判断对象是否为空是一个常见的操作,它主要用于防止程序在运行过程中遇到NullPointerException。以下是一些常用的判断对象是否为空的方法,并附带相应的Java代码示例。 1. 使用if语句判断引用是否为null 这是最基本的判空方法,通过检查对象引用是否为null来判断对象是否为空。 java Object obj = null; if (...
一种是org.apache.commons.lang3包下的; 另一种是org.springframework.util包下的。这两种StringUtils工具类判断对象是否为空是有差距的: StringUtils.isEmpty(CharSequence cs); //org.apache.commons.lang3包下的StringUtils类,判断是否为空的方法参数是字符序列类,也就是String类型 StringUtils.isEmpty(Object str...
“java”中判断对象是否为空的方法有三种,分别是:一、根据“for...in”遍历对象,如果存在则返回“true”,否则返回“false”;二、利用“ES6”中“Object.keys()”来进行判断;三、利用JSON自带的方法进行判断。 大家好,我是架构君,一个会写代码吟诗的架构师。今天说一说总结java中判断对象是否为空的方法,希望能...
最简单的方法是直接使用null来判断对象是否为空。如果一个对象的值为null,则说明该对象是空的。 if (obj == null) { // 对象为空的处理逻辑 } 使用isEmpty()方法对于一些集合类对象(如List、Set、Map等),可以使用isEmpty()方法来判断集合是否为空。如果集合中没有任何元素,则isEmpty()方法返回true。 List...
在Java中,"空对象"通常指的是没有任何有效数据的对象。这可能意味着对象的所有字段都是null,或者该对象是一个空的集合,或者是实现了特定接口或继承了特定类的空对象。 在Java中,你可以使用以下几种方法来判断一个对象是否为空: 1.使用null判断 在Java中,你可以使用null来判断一个对象是否为空。如果对象是null,...
在Java中,可以使用以下方法判断对象是否为空:1. 使用null判断:使用"=="运算符将对象与null进行比较。如果对象等于null,表示对象为空。```javaif (object =...
在Java中,可以使用关键字null来表示一个空对象。使用关键字null判断一个对象是否为空,可以通过与null进行比较。如果对象引用变量与null相等,则表示该对象为空。 以下是使用关键字判断对象是否为空的示例代码: Objectobj=null;if(obj==null){System.out.println("对象为空");}else{System.out.println("对象不为空...
如果对象为集合,则获取集合的大小,如果大小为0,则表示没有值。 如果对象为Map,则获取Map的大小,如果大小为0,则表示没有值。 最后,如果对象不为空且有值,则返回false。 4. 类图 以下是判断对象是否为空或者对象中没有值的类图: ObjectUtils+isNull(Object obj) : boolean+isEmpty(Object obj) : boolean ...
在Java中,可以使用以下几种方法来判断一个对象是否为空:1. 使用 `==` 运算符判断是否为 `null`:通过将对象与 `null` 进行比较,如果相等则表示对象为空。```javaif (ob...
一个对象如果有可能是null的话,首先要做的就是判断是否为null:object == null,否则就有可能会出现空指针异常,这个通常是我们在进行数据库的查询操作时,查询结果首先用object != null,进行非空判断,然后再进行其他的业务逻辑,这样可以避免出现空指针异常。